+struct ib_ucontext *ehca_alloc_ucontext(struct ib_device *device,
+ struct ib_udata *udata)
+{
+ struct ehca_ucontext *my_context = NULL;
+ EHCA_CHECK_ADR_P(device);
+ EDEB_EN(7, "device=%p name=%s", device, device->name);
+ my_context = kmalloc(sizeof *my_context, GFP_KERNEL);
+ if (NULL == my_context) {
+ EDEB_ERR(4, "Out of memory device=%p", device);
+ return ERR_PTR(-ENOMEM);
+ }
+ memset(my_context, 0, sizeof(*my_context));
+ EDEB_EX(7, "device=%p ucontext=%p", device, my_context);
+ return &my_context->ib_ucontext;
+}
+
+int ehca_dealloc_ucontext(struct ib_ucontext *context)
+{
+ struct ehca_ucontext *my_context = NULL;
+ EHCA_CHECK_ADR(context);
+ EDEB_EN(7, "ucontext=%p", context);
+ my_context = container_of(context, struct ehca_ucontext, ib_ucontext);
+ kfree(my_context);
+ EDEB_EN(7, "ucontext=%p", context);
+ return 0;
+}
+
+struct page *ehca_nopage(struct vm_area_struct *vma,
+ unsigned long address, int *type)
+{
+ struct page *mypage = 0;
+ u64 fileoffset = vma->vm_pgoff << PAGE_SHIFT;
+ u32 idr_handle = fileoffset >> 32;
+ u32 q_type = (fileoffset >> 28) & 0xF; /* CQ, QP,... */
+ u32 rsrc_type = (fileoffset >> 24) & 0xF; /* sq,rq,cmnd_window */
+
+ EDEB_EN(7,
+ "vm_start=%lx vm_end=%lx vm_page_prot=%lx vm_fileoff=%lx",
+ vma->vm_start, vma->vm_end, vma->vm_page_prot, fileoffset);
+
+
+ if (q_type == 1) { /* CQ */
+ struct ehca_cq *cq;
+
+ down_read(&ehca_cq_idr_sem);
+ cq = idr_find(&ehca_cq_idr, idr_handle);
+ up_read(&ehca_cq_idr_sem);
+
+ /* make sure this mmap really belongs to the authorized user */
+ if (cq == 0) {
+ EDEB_ERR(4, "cq is NULL ret=NOPAGE_SIGBUS");
+ return NOPAGE_SIGBUS;
+ }
+ if (rsrc_type == 2) {
+ void *vaddr;
+ EDEB(6, "cq=%p cq queuearea", cq);
+ vaddr = address - vma->vm_start
+ + cq->ehca_cq_core.ipz_queue.queue;
+ EDEB(6, "queue=%p vaddr=%p",
+ cq->ehca_cq_core.ipz_queue.queue, vaddr);
+ mypage = vmalloc_to_page(vaddr);
+ }
+ } else if (q_type == 2) { /* QP */
+ struct ehca_qp *qp;
+
+ down_read(&ehca_qp_idr_sem);
+ qp = idr_find(&ehca_qp_idr, idr_handle);
+ up_read(&ehca_qp_idr_sem);
+
+ /* make sure this mmap really belongs to the authorized user */
+ if (qp == NULL) {
+ EDEB_ERR(4, "qp is NULL ret=NOPAGE_SIGBUS");
+ return NOPAGE_SIGBUS;
+ }
+ if (rsrc_type == 2) { /* rqueue */
+ void *vaddr;
+ EDEB(6, "qp=%p qp rqueuearea", qp);
+ vaddr = address - vma->vm_start
+ + qp->ehca_qp_core.ipz_rqueue.queue;
+ EDEB(6, "rqueue=%p vaddr=%p",
+ qp->ehca_qp_core.ipz_rqueue.queue, vaddr);
+ mypage = vmalloc_to_page(vaddr);
+ } else if (rsrc_type == 3) { /* squeue */
+ void *vaddr;
+ EDEB(6, "qp=%p qp squeuearea", qp);
+ vaddr = address - vma->vm_start
+ + qp->ehca_qp_core.ipz_squeue.queue;
+ EDEB(6, "squeue=%p vaddr=%p",
+ qp->ehca_qp_core.ipz_squeue.queue, vaddr);
+ mypage = vmalloc_to_page(vaddr);
+ }
+ }
+ if (mypage == 0) {
+ EDEB_ERR(4, "Invalid page adr==NULL ret=NOPAGE_SIGBUS");
+ return NOPAGE_SIGBUS;
+ }
+ get_page(mypage);
+ EDEB_EX(7, "page adr=%p", mypage);
+ return mypage;
+}
+
+static struct vm_operations_struct ehcau_vm_ops = {
+ .nopage = ehca_nopage,
+};
